A ROBIN'S-EGG-GLAZED HU
QING DYNASTY, 18TH/19TH CENTURY

Of flattened pear shape, the vase is moulded with evenly spaced sets of vertical ribbed flanges around the neck, mid and lower sections, with a pair of elephant-head loop handles on the shoulders, and applied overall with a mottled glaze of turquoise and lapis-blue tones
12 1/4 in. (31 cm.) high, box, stand
